The Fascinating World of Bioluminescence: From Fireflies to Deep-Sea Creatures

Bioluminescence, the production and emission of light by living organisms, is a captivating natural phenomenon that has mesmerized humans for centuries. From the flickering glow of fireflies in summer nights to the eerie luminescence of deep-sea creatures, bioluminescence showcases the incredible diversity and ingenuity of life on Earth. This article delves into the fascinating world of bioluminescence, exploring its diverse mechanisms, ecological significance, and potential applications.

The Chemistry of Light: A Look Inside the Bioluminescent Reaction

At the heart of bioluminescence lies a complex chemical reaction involving a molecule called luciferin and an enzyme called luciferase. When luciferin reacts with oxygen in the presence of luciferase, it undergoes a series of chemical transformations, releasing energy in the form of light. The color of the emitted light depends on the specific luciferin and luciferase involved, ranging from blue to green, yellow, orange, and even red.

The chemical reaction is typically catalyzed by the enzyme luciferase, which acts as a catalyst, speeding up the process. Interestingly, the process is highly efficient, converting almost all the chemical energy into light energy, unlike traditional light sources that produce a significant amount of heat. The bioluminescent reaction occurs in specialized cells called photocytes, which are often concentrated in specific organs or tissues.

Diverse Applications of Bioluminescence in Nature

Bioluminescence serves a wide array of purposes in the natural world, ranging from communication to prey attraction and defense. Fireflies, for instance, use their bioluminescent flashes to attract mates and communicate with each other. Deep-sea fish, living in the dark abyss, rely on bioluminescence for various functions, including finding prey, attracting mates, and even illuminating their surroundings.

In some cases, bioluminescence acts as a defensive mechanism. Squid and jellyfish, for example, can release bioluminescent ink to confuse predators and escape. Other species use bioluminescence as a form of camouflage, blending in with the faint light of the deep ocean. The diversity of functions and adaptations associated with bioluminescence highlights its crucial role in shaping the evolution and ecological interactions of these organisms.

Bioluminescence in Research and Technology

Beyond its natural beauty and ecological significance, bioluminescence has become a valuable tool in various scientific fields. Biologists use bioluminescent organisms as reporters to track gene expression, study cell processes, and monitor environmental pollution. The bioluminescence of certain bacteria is also used in bioremediation, where they break down pollutants and clean up contaminated sites.

Furthermore, scientists are exploring the potential of bioluminescence in developing new technologies. Researchers are investigating the use of bioluminescent proteins as biosensors for early disease detection and environmental monitoring. The high efficiency and sensitivity of bioluminescence offer advantages over traditional fluorescent technologies, opening exciting possibilities for future applications.
